Who is the 10-day vignette for?
The 10-day vignette suits weekend trips, one-week holidays, and multi-day transit through Austria — the most popular choice for tourists driving to Italy, Slovenia, or Croatia via the Brenner or Tauern corridors.
It is valid for ten consecutive calendar days from the start date you choose (until 23:59 on the last day). Motorcycles use a lower tariff; select motorcycle at checkout if applicable.
When does it start?
The digital 10-day vignette activates on the start date you select at purchase — for same-day travel you can choose today.
Unlike 2-month or annual ASFINAG products sold to private consumers, there is no 18-day waiting period for the 10-day pass.
What it covers
All standard ASFINAG motorways and expressways where a vignette is required — the same network as the 1-day and annual products.
Camper vans and cars up to 3.5 t are covered under the car category. Check vehicle type at checkout if you drive a motorcycle.
What is not included
Section tolls: Brenner (A13), Arlberg tunnel (S16), Karawanken, Tauern (A10), Gleinalm, and similar routes require separate payment.
Distance-based toll for trucks over 3.5 t (GO-Box) is a different system — not sold here.

FAQ — Austria 10-day vignette
Do I need a vignette in Austria?
Yes. Every vehicle up to 3.5 tonnes using Austrian motorways (Autobahn) or expressways (Schnellstraße) must have a valid vignette. This includes transit trips — even passing through for 20 minutes requires one.
What is the fine for driving without a vignette in Austria?
The substitute toll is €120, payable on the spot. If not paid, penalties can escalate up to €3,000. Automatic cameras scan license plates, so getting caught is essentially guaranteed.
How fast does the digital vignette activate?
The 1-day and 10-day digital vignettes activate immediately after purchase. Unlike the 2-month and annual versions (which have an 18-day legal waiting period when bought directly from ASFINAG), short-term vignettes are usable right away.
Does my vignette cover the Brenner Pass or Arlberg Tunnel?
No. Several special routes require additional tolls: Brenner Pass (A13), Arlberg Tunnel (S16), Karawanken Tunnel, Tauern Tunnel, Pyhrn Autobahn. These are paid separately at toll stations. The regular vignette covers the rest of the network.
Can I use the vignette if I change my license plate?
No. The digital vignette is linked to a specific license plate number. If you change plates (new car, new registration), you need to purchase a new vignette. Store your confirmation email — you may need it to claim a partial refund from ASFINAG in case of a total loss.
Do motorcycles need an Austrian vignette?
Yes. Motorcycles need their own vignette (at a reduced rate). The digital version is linked to the plate, so it works the same way as for cars.
